Ideal candidates should display the following requirements and work habits:
- Provide adequate transportation to and from work.
- Must be able to lift 50 lbs.
- Must be able to stand and walk for long periods of time.
- Possess the ability to work outdoors in a changing environment.
- Must have the ability to work any days of the week, a set 40-hour schedule.
- Team player – Enjoys working with others and in a public setting.
- Self-starter – able to work with minimal supervision and identify/workplace needs.
- Communication – able to communicate clearly and concisely.
- Represents Gulf Corp Services professionally in interactions with employees, owners, guests, and community members.
- Sweeps, mops, scrubs, and vacuums floors using cleaning solutions and equipment.
- Cleans walls, ceilings, windows, walkways, stairwells, elevator cars, equipment, and building fixtures.
- Gathers and empties trash from building floors, parking lots, and parking garages.
- Sets up, arranges, and removes decorations, tables, and chairs in meeting rooms.
- Cleans pool deck areas including pool furniture.
- Picks up trash from landscaped areas, parking lots/decks, and common areas.
- Maintains trash compactor room and rotates dumpsters as needed.
- Reports safety hazards.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
